Output 366aaeef93164708477e90f6b339cd4b10192901b7f0691fbbf53f773fb615be:31

value
2387518
script pubkey
OP_0 OP_PUSHBYTES_20 fe2f5ad6ca1232e78dd6a5143cfa43fe0a574e52
address
bc1qlch444k2zgew0rwk552re7jrlc99wnjjq0dfgz
transaction
366aaeef93164708477e90f6b339cd4b10192901b7f0691fbbf53f773fb615be
confirmations
250354
spent
true